Amazon India launches new enhanced features for DSP programme

On August 31, Amazon India announced that it is enhancing its Delivery Service Partner programme and will provide its technology, logistics, and hiring partners with greater support and other features.

Amazon's upgraded DSP programme will create job and business opportunities in India


The business has onboarded 40 new partners for its revamped DSP programme and plans to continue to expand it across India, ET Bureau reported. India follows the U.S., Canada, the UK, Germany, France, Italy, Spain, Ireland, Brazil, and the Netherlands to launch the revamped programme. Amazon has invested over $1 billion (Rs 6,652.8 crore) in the global programme thus far.
 
“We launched the DSP programme in 2015 and we already have more than 300 partners working with us,” Akhil Saxena, Amazon’s vice president for customer fulfilment (APAC, MENA and LATAM), told the Press Trust of India. “India is the 11th country where Amazon is rolling out the revamped programme, under which we will offer newer services, including allocation of an account manager to the DSP partner and value-added tools for hiring, legal and technological support.”

The new, ameliorated DSP programme will give logistics entrepreneurs opportunities for rapid growth, according to Amazon. It will also create further employment opportunities.
 
“We want to enable aspiring entrepreneurs, even with little to no delivery experience, to develop and launch their own delivery businesses,” said Saxena. “These new small business owners are supported by the backing of Amazon's more than 20 years of operational experience, technology, and a suite of exclusively negotiated services and assets required to deliver Amazon packages safely and successfully.”
